Predeceased by parents, Howard & Evelyn VanDuyneTom grew up in Far Hills, New Jersey, and lived in Pottersville for many years, then moved to Flemington about 2014. He graduated from Bernards High School in Bernardsville.

Tom worked as a horse groomer and trainer for 20 years. He also worked as a carpet installer.

Tom loved fishing and spending time with his family. He belonged to the Moose Lodge #816 in Hackettstown.

He died at Morristown Medical Center in Morristown, New Jersey. He is survived by his daughter and son, along with their spouses. He is also survived by his three sisters and their families.

Tom was buried at Fairmount Cemetery in Tewkskbury Township on Saturday, July 22, 2017.
